Run Britain
- My World Record-Breaking Adventure to Run Every Mile of the British Coastline
- Written by: Nick Butter
- Narrated by: Nick Butter
- Length: 9 hrs and 56 mins
- Unabridged
-
Overall
-
Performance
-
Story
In the spring of 2021, as the UK's latest pandemic lockdowns were lifted, Nick Butter set out from the Eden Project to become the fastest person to cover every mile of Britain's mainland coastline on foot. Battling the most extreme winds Britain had seen in 100 years, days of torrential rain and the unrelenting hills of Western Scotland and Cornwall, Nick suffered two broken bones and countless injuries, whilst taking on two marathons a day, every day, for 100 days.

How Far Can You Go?
- My 25-Year Quest to Walk Again
- Written by: John Maclean, Mark Tabb
- Narrated by: Mark Englhardt
- Length: 6 hrs and 34 mins
- Unabridged
-
Overall
-
Performance
-
Story
An inspirational memoir by a man who became an elite wheelchair athlete after suffering a catastrophic spinal injury and who finally walked again 25 years after his accident. After two years of intense physical therapy following his crippling accident, John Maclean set a new course for himself when his father encouraged him to embrace his new reality and asked: "How far can you go"? Inspired, Maclean became the first paraplegic to complete the Ironman World Championship and swim the English Channel before going on to win a silver medal for rowing at the 2008 Paralympic Games.

Marathon Quest
- Written by: Martin Parnell
- Narrated by: Bill Russell
- Length: 6 hrs and 15 mins
- Unabridged
-
Overall
-
Performance
-
Story
In 2005, during a four-month cycling trip through Africa, Martin Parnell was struck by the power of sport and its ability to bring people together and to bring about change. Five years later, the 55-year-old mining engineer, husband, father and grandfather dedicated a year of his life to run 250 marathons with the aim of raising $250,000 for the charity Right to Play, an international humanitarian organization that reaches out to disadvantaged children around the world.
